The singer who experienced clinical death: "When I regained consciousness, I knew exactly who was there"

Singer Haim Tzadik, who experienced clinical death following a severe car accident, recalls: "I saw my late grandmother, she smiled at me, and I saw the family outside the room. When I regained consciousness, I knew exactly who was there and what they were wearing."

Taxi driver attacked at 100 km/h crashes into barrier to save himself

Three young men are accused of attempting to rob a taxi driver they summoned on Highway 31. While the vehicle was moving at 100 km/h, the suspects beat and choked the driver. To stop the assault and protect other road users, the driver steered the taxi into a concrete barrier.

Be'er Sheva supermarket stabbing: Attempted murder caught on camera

Maher Al-Gargawi (20) from Segev Shalom has been indicted for the attempted murder of a young man at a supermarket in Be'er Sheva. Alongside an accomplice who remains at large, he stabbed the victim during a violent family feud. The victim identified the defendant during the police investigation.

Apartment with illegal residents exposed in the heart of Be'er Sheva

During a police enforcement operation in Be'er Sheva, officers discovered a partitioned apartment housing eight illegal residents from the territories. Southern District Police Commander, Nitzav Haim Bublil, has signed an administrative order to close the property for 30 days.

Celebrities earning 60,000 shekels cancel deals: Dramatic data from the Ministry of Finance

Behind the wave of deal cancellations, the Ministry of Finance has identified a concerning trend: wealthy individuals, including celebrities, are purchasing apartments from contractors and canceling contracts without facing penalties. Experts point to aggressive developer financing campaigns as the primary driver.

Violent robbery in Be'er Sheva: Negev resident attacked a woman in a wheelchair

An 18-year-old is charged with aggravated robbery and the fraudulent use of a payment instrument. According to the indictment, the suspect stopped a woman in a wheelchair at night, punched her, and forcibly stole her bag before attempting to use her stolen credit card in Rahat.

A gap of over 10 million shekels: Investigation into a dentist from the south

The Tax Authority is investigating a dentist from Be'er Sheva on suspicion of failing to report income of millions of shekels. According to the suspicion, the gap between deposits and reports exceeded 10 million shekels, real estate assets were omitted from a capital declaration, and a residential address was not updated.

First publication: Tens of thousands of Be'er Sheva residents to be eligible for firearms

Significant parts of the city are now included in the list of areas where residents can apply for a personal weapon license. Since the start of the weapons reform, over 200 settlements have been recognized as eligible.

Indictment filed against Be'er Sheva Deputy Mayor for assaulting employee while in uniform

An indictment has been filed against Be'er Sheva Deputy Mayor Shimon Tobul for assaulting a Bedouin gas station employee. According to the charges, Tobul, while wearing a military uniform, struck the man, pushed another employee, and brandished his weapon following a dispute over Arabic music.

Collected protection money and threatened: "If you don't pay - we will burn the place down"

An indictment was filed against Abu Ja'afar, a resident of Be'er Sheva, and Abu Assa, a resident of Tel Sheva, after they collected protection money from a kiosk. According to the investigation, after the employee paid the protection money several times, he said he had no money - and in response, the two started a violent confrontation and threatened him with a knife.
